What began as a small glove-making business back in 1946 is now one of Germany's largest motorcycle clothing and accessory firms. Ever since they developed the first out-and-out racing glove for Toni Mang, back in 1983, Held has rightly been regarded as THE glove brand. Continuous development and innovation coupled with top-quality craftsmanship have built an excellent reputation. And one that has long since extended far beyond gloves: textile and leather clothing, helmets, tank bags and saddlebags are just a few of the products from the Allgäu-based family firm creating a sensation around the biking world.

Held Air n Dry 2242 with GORE-TEX
These Held GORE-TEX gloves with the brand-new GORE 2-in-1 technology offer quick and easy changeover between two chambers, thus allowing you to alternate between protection against the wet and tactile grip - ideal for touring in sunny but changeable weather conditions.
Comfort/features:- Upper chamber features a breathable, wind- and waterproof GORE-TEX membrane, based on P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ene)
- Lower chamber with the unlined palm for direct grip
- Knuckle guard
- Ball of thumb padding, reinforced with SuperFabric brand material (68% epoxy resin, 32% polyester)
- Perforated palm for enhanced breathability
- 3M Scotchlite reflective material
- Stretch on back and fingers
- Hook-and-loop strap for width adjustment at wrist and cuff
- Visor wiper
Material:
- Back made of CORDURA special fabric (100% polyamide) and leather trim
- Palm made of highly abrasion-resistant kangaroo leather
Lightweight lining (100% polyester)
GORE 2-in-1 technology- Optimum comfort whatever the weather - rain or fine
- One glove, two options: optimum rain protection in the waterproof chamber or a pleasantly cool feel in the grip chamber when biking in summer temperatures
- In the rain protection chamber, optimum comfort is ensured by the GORE-TEX X-TRAFIT Product Technology - permanently breathable, wind- and waterproof
- The grip chamber is unlined on the palm and thus offers maximum tactility and excellent breathability
Certificates:
- EN 13594:2015

"Motorradfahrer" magazine tested nine different multi-season gloves in its 4-2014 issue. The Held Air n Dry was given a "RECOMMENDED BY MOTORRADFAHRER" endorsement. The glove was awarded 5 out of 5 stars in all four categories (Specifications, Safety, Comfort, Moisture Protection and Price). The following features were given special mention:
- Generous cut
- Perfect fit
- Sufficient freedom of movement
- Long cuff which can be adjusted to be very thin
- Sensitive grip
- Sturdy
- Very well finished
- Very good value for money
(In total, three of the gloves tested received a Motorradfahrer Recommendation)View all test reports

"Motoretta" magazine tested the Held Air n Dry in its November 2012 issue and awarded it a PRACTICAL RECOMMENDATION.
"In summer temperatures, this glove offers good airflow combined with the responsive grip of a lightweight summer glove. The Dry compartment offers your fingers perfect protection against the rain, while the all-round lining keeps your hand warm...the grip feel is superior to that of a lined multi-season glove..."
